Summary

Fibrous materials with special wetting properties, such as superhydrophobic/superoleophobic, superhydrophilic/superoleophilic, superhydrophobic/superoleophilic, and superhydrophilic/superoleophobic, exhibit numerous functions, e.g. bio-mimicking anti- sticking, contamination-resistant, self-cleaning. Their emerging applications include self-cleaning, oil-water separation, energy conversion, protection of electronic devices, controlling cell-substrate adhesion, and reducing fluid resistance for aquaculture and microfluidic devices, etc. Nanofibers having special wettability that are permeable to air and moisture are very useful for the development of protective suits, healthcare products, and filtration media. This presentation summarizes our recent academic results on functional fibrous materials with special wettability and their potential applications in air filtration, waterproof and breathable membranes, oil-water separation, dye adsorption, microwave adsorption, etc. It also introduces our industrialization achievements of electrospinning machines and nanofiber products.

Keynote Speaker

Prof. ZHOU Hua

Professor, College of Textiles & Clothing, Qingdao University

Prof. Hua Zhou is a Professor at Qingdao University, China. She received Ph.D. degree in Materials Engineering from Deakin University in Australia, 2014. She then worked as an Alfred Deakin Postdoctoral Research Fellow (2014-2016), and Research Fellow (2016-2019) at Institute for Frontier Materials, Deakin University. So far, she has over 70 high quality publications in Chemical Reviews, Advanced Materials, Advanced Functional Materials, Materials Horizons, Chemical Engineering Journal and etc. The total citation is over 6000 with Hindex is 42. In recent years, as chief investigator, she secured numerous important funding grants, including National Natural Science Foundation of China, Natural Science Foundation of Shandong Province, the "Textile Light" China National Textile Federation, etc. Her research interests are surface finishing technology of functional textile materials; fluoro-free super-liquid-repellent fabric coatings; large scale production and application of functional nanofiber materials.
